Responsibilities

  • Provides quality customer service to customers by providing one-on-one attention to detail.
  • Perform general cleaning functions in a hospital environment.
  • Cleaning of patient rooms.
  • Changing linen on patient beds.
  • Cleaning of vacant rooms and make-ready for occupancy.
  • Trash collection and removal.
  • Restocking hospital bathrooms and housekeeping supplies.
  • Meets staff development/training requirements for position.
  • Sweeps, scrubs, mops and polishes floors.
  • Vacuums carpets, rugs, and draperies.
  • Shampoos carpets, rugs and upholstery as needed.
  • Dust and polishes furniture and fittings.
  • Cleans metal fixtures and fittings.
  • Empties and cleans trash containers.
  • Disposes of trash in a sanitary manner.
  • Cleans wash basins, mirrors, tubs and showers.
  • Wipes down glass surfaces.
  • Responds to customer (patient, visitors, staff) queries and requests.
  • Responds to calls for housekeeping problems, such as spills and broken glass.
  • Contributes to team efforts; exhibits professionalism with customers and staff
  • Communicate effectively with coworkers, patients and visitors. Must maintain a phone and keep leadership aware of any phone changes.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
  • May be requested to be member of QI team.
  • Fulfills laundry duties
